Durability and Maintenance: Quartz vs Marble

Quartz shower walls are engineered stone, combining natural quartz with resins and pigments. This process makes them highly resistant to scratches, stains, and moisture. Unlike marble, quartz doesn't require sealing and is easy to clean with mild soap. Marble, while luxurious, is a natural stone with porous surfaces that can absorb water, leading to stains and etching if not properly sealed. Regular sealing (every 6-12 months) is essential for marble to prevent damage.

Aesthetic Appeal: Modern Quartz vs Classic Marble

Quartz offers a modern, consistent look with a wide range of colors and patterns. It's ideal for contemporary bathrooms seeking a sleek, uniform appearance. Marble, however, brings timeless elegance with unique veining and variations, creating a sophisticated, high-end feel. The natural beauty of marble can make your shower a focal point, but the pattern may not match every design style.

Cost and Long-Term Value: Budget Considerations

Quartz is generally more affordable than marble, with installation costs ranging from $50 to $100 per square foot compared to marble's $80 to $150+. Quartz's low maintenance and durability mean fewer replacement costs over time. Marble's higher initial cost and ongoing maintenance (sealing, potential repairs) can add up. For a cost-effective, long-lasting solution, quartz is often the practical choice.
